Welcome to the HIV Forum. There is little risk to you for HIV from the exposure you describe. it is not clear if your oral sex was condom protected or not. If both your oral and your vaginal sex was condom protected, there is no risk and no reason for concern, nor any reason to abstain for fear of giving something to a partner. If only the vaginal sex was condom protected, there is still no reason for concern
The contact of saliva with a cut/open sore at the base of your penis does not change this.
Your negative tests at 14 days is also strong evidence that you did not get HIV for this exposure. The combo test provides completely reliable results at 4 weeks and the majority of infected persons have positive tests after 14 days.
Hope these comments are helpful. I see little reason for concern. EWH
